Struthers lost against Hubbard back in October of 2024, and unfortunately they wound up with the same result on Monday. The Wildcats came up short against the Eagles, falling 6-1. Struthers have now taken an 'L' in back-to-back games.
Struthers' defeat dropped their record down to 2-5. As for Hubbard, their victory (their first of the season) made their record 1-5-1.
Coming up, Struthers will challenge Lakeview at 7:30 p.m. on Thursday. Struthers' defense better be ready for this one: Lakeview have averaged an impressive 3.3 goals per game this season. As for Hubbard, they will welcome South Range at 7:30 p.m. on Thursday. Hubbard will be up against South Range's rather soft defense (which has allowed 3.88 goals per contest), so fans could be in store for a big offensive performance.
